What Are the Side Effects of Oral Diabetes Medications?

Side effects of first- and second-generation sulfonylurea medicine include:

Hypoglycemia (low blood glucose)
Upset stomach
Skin rash or itching
Weight gain

Side effects for biguanide medications include:

Upset stomach (nausea, diarrhea)
Metallic taste in mouth

Side effects for thiazolidinediones are rare but may include:


Elevated liver enzymes
Liver failure
Respiratory infection
Headache
Fluid retention
Side effects for alpha-glucosidase inhibitors include:

Stomach upset (gas, diarrhea, nausea, cramps)

Side effects of meglitinides include:

Hypoglycemia (low blood glucose)
Stomach upset

Always take your oral diabetes medicine exactly as prescribed
and discuss any specific concerns you might have with your
health care provider.
